Paralegal
The Air Line Pilots Association, International (ALPA) , the largest airline pilot union in the world and the largest non-governmental aviation safety organization in the world seeks an experienced Paralegal for our office in Atlanta, GA to represent over 17,000 Delta pilots. Under general supervision and within the limitations of Association policy, the Paralegal provides contractual and legal research support and assists in the analysis of contractual disputes. They work closely with MEC officers, representatives, and committee volunteers to assist in gathering information and evidence in order to review and analyze potential contract issues, and support and assist in the development of strategies and tactics for resolution. They interact with pilot members to assess whether potential disputes exist under the Pilot Working Agreement (PWA) and, if so, work with management representatives to informally resolve the dispute while also handling contractual appeals of disputes that are not resolved earlier in the resolution process, including the subsequent processing of cases to the System Board of Adjustment, the preparation of the cases at the Board, and the preparation of post-hearing briefs. They also provide support and assistance in the preparation and processing of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) enforcement cases at all stages, up to and including appeals and filing appeal briefs. Individual responsibility and administrative ability are both required to ensure that tasks are carried out as assigned and important deadlines are meet. Excellent note taking skills in a high-volume environment and ability to travel frequently (20 40%) and for prolonged periods of time required.

Qualifications:
- High school diploma required; Bachelors degree in relevant area, e.g., English, Paralegal Studies, Political Science, Pre-Law, or related field, from an accredited college or university preferred; or, the equivalent combination of education and practical experience.
- Two (2) years of paralegal experience required; five (5) or more years strongly preferred.
- Paralegal Certificate strongly preferred.
- Ability to take accurate fast notes and/or shorthand in a high-volume setting required.
- Understanding of collective bargaining agreements, corporate practices, and applicable regulations preferred with a strong preference for an understanding of pilot contracts and Federal Aviation Regulations (FARs).
- Knowledge of pilot scheduling, work rules, and benefits issues, e.g., vacation, sick leave, and the like, strongly preferred.
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, oral and written, for effective interaction with internal staff, external contacts, and pilots.
- Excellent organizational skills.
- Able to work independently and to be proactive in identifying and responding to issues and problems.
- Software: Microsoft Outlook, Word, Excel, and PowerPoint required; SharePoint preferred.
